Skill Enhancement Centre is a business Consultancy firm focused on small/medium  businesses. Our goal is to provide our clients with the support they need to grow their businesses by providing them with value -added and convenient services in a friendly atmosphere.

Location: Lagos
Job Responsibilities

• Researching, analyzing and monitoring economic developments and issues of importance to the Lagos & Nigerian business community, and helping to shape government policy on investment and trade.
• To take a lead role in several areas and contribute to all the others; including fiscal and monetary policy, investment issues impacting on the local business and national business environment
• Prepare papers on policy-orientated economics issues for discussion at the chambers business roundtable forums
• Prepare draft position papers and memoranda of the Chamber
• Liaise with the Advocacy Manager and Public Relations Manager in preparation of Press Conference papers and speeches.
• Provide secretarial support to the Economic and Statistics Committee
• Support the Advocacy Manager through provision of timely information on macroeconomic issues and other Government policies that have potential to affect the business community adversely
• Generate regular report on national economic issue.
• Provide regular information on trends of major economic indicators such as inflation rate, interest rate, global oil prices, exchange rate, as well as domestic and external debt
• Keep an up-to-date record of policy pronouncements by the Government at both the State and Federal levels
• Undertake quarterly surveys of the business through visits to business operators
• Gather sectoral data on the performance of the various sectors of the economy; with preparation of quarterly sectoral report.
• Carry out other assignment as may be assigned by direct line manager.

Qualification/Experience
• A good first & Masters’ Degree in Economics.
• 6 years’ experience, 2 of which must be in a similar role.
• Strong research and analytical skills, as well as inter-personal skills and initiative.
• Demonstrable skills in Microsoft Office productivity software like Microsoft Word, Microsoft Excel Microsoft PowerPoint and Microsoft Outlook.
• Demonstrated ability to carry out complex economic research and analysis activity across business sectors of the national economy and other relevant international economy indicators.
• Knowledge of macroeconomics and other relevant economic indices
• Demonstrated working knowledge of productivity tools such as the Microsoft Word, Excel, Access, etc.
• Demonstrated ability to work with a diversity of individuals and/or groups; work with a variety of data; and utilize specific information,
• Good data gathering and analytical skills
• Good Project management skills
• Good business writing, presentation and facilitation skills
• Strong leadership and people management skills
• Good interpersonal skills
